The Empire Plan is a unique health insurance plan designed especially for public employees in New York State. Empire Plan benefits include inpatient and outpatient hospital coverage, medical/surgical coverage, Centers of Excellence for transplants, infertility and cancer, home care services, equipment and supplies, mental health and substance abuse coverage and prescription drug coverage.

We are pleased to announce that a revised NYSHIP General Information Book (GIB) for all Active NY groups (Empire Plan and HMO) is on its way to enrollee homes and NY agencies.
A Single Book!
In a departure from past practices, this publication completely replaces all group specific General Information Books for HMO enrollees and will partially replace all group specific General Information Books/Empire Plan Certificates for Empire Plan enrollees (see attached list for specific publications that should be recycled). We believe this initiative will simplify our NYSHIP materials for both enrollees and HBAs and significantly reduce costs. Group specific versions of updated Empire Plan Certificates are under development and will be reissued in the near future. NOTE: The back cover of the version that is being mailed to Empire Plan enrollees instructs them to keep the new GIB with their existing General Information Book/Certificate until they receive their new group specific Empire Plan Certificate.
The General Information Book contains information regarding NYSHIP eligibility rules, enrollment options, requirements and costs. Provisions are generally the same for all active NY enrollee groups; however where there are exceptions the differences are called out in the text. This reissuance represents the most substantial revision to the GIB undertaken in more than a decade, so we highly recommend that all HBAs take the opportunity to review it upon receipt.
Empire Plan Certificates Update
Earlier this summer, the 2012-13 Empire Plan Certificate Amendments were posted online and rolled into the online group Certificates. Amendments for 2014 are in development and when they are posted, we will print and mail new Empire Plan Certificates by group to all active Empire Plan enrollees. Once these second publications are available, they will replace each group’s existing GIB/Empire Plan Certificate and significantly streamline our fulfillment system. We will send another HBA memo to let you know when this change is occurring and include a list of Empire Plan materials that you can recycle. Future revisions to the GIB and Empire Plan Certificates will be handled separately and our intent is to stop issuing amendments in favor of revising the books instead.
